1 逻辑架构 1.1 逻辑架构图 1.2 组件说明 一、mongos(query routers):查询路由,负责client的连接,并把任务分给shards,然后收集结果。一个集群可以有多个query routers(replica sets),以分担 ...
原文作者: xingguang 原文链接:https: www.tiance.club post .html 分片集群 . 概念 分片集群是将数据存储在多台机器上的操作,主要由查询路由mongos 分片 配置服务器组成。 查询路由根据配置服务器上的元数据将请求分发到相应的分片上,本身不存储集群的元数据,只是缓存在内存中。 分片用来存储数据块。数据集根据分片键将集合分割为数据块,存储在不同的分片上。 ...
2020-05-05 12:14 0 693 推荐指数:
1 逻辑架构 1.1 逻辑架构图 1.2 组件说明 一、mongos(query routers):查询路由,负责client的连接,并把任务分给shards,然后收集结果。一个集群可以有多个query routers(replica sets),以分担 ...
----------------------------------------复制集---------------------------------------- 一、复制集概述 Mongodb复制集(replica set)由一组Mongod实例(进程)组成,包含一个Primary节点 ...
mongo除了单机部署,那么集群搭建可分为:可复制集、分片集群。 可复制集:每个master主后面都有N个slave备用节点。(生产环境推荐的部署模式) 分片集群:同时拥有多个可复制集,每个可复制集有自己的master和slave节点。 【可复制集】 读写分离,负载均衡,避免数据丢失 ...
1:启动三个实例 配置文件如下: 2:进入一台机器进行初始化: 3:创建分片的复制集 启动: 要注意一点,如果是添加分片复制集的话。每一个分片要指定 ...
前面的文章介绍了Mongodb的安装使用,在 MongoDB 中,有两种数据冗余方式,一种 是 Master-Slave 模式(主从复制),一种是 Replica Sets 模式(副本集)。 Mongodb一共有三种集群搭建的方式: Replica Set(副本 ...
介绍了Mongodb的安装使用,在 MongoDB 中,有两种数据冗余方式,一种 是 Master-Slave 模式(主从复制),一种是 Replica Sets 模式(副本集)。 1 2 3 ...
无聊,自建轮子 共两部分 1复制集 2分片集 1复制集 创建mongo镜像,dockerfile如下 from centos:7RUN yum install net-tools vim -yRUN mkdir -p /mongodb/{bin,data,log,conf ...
mongodb是最常用的noSql数据库,在数据库排名中已经上升到了前五。这篇文章介绍如何搭建高可用的mongodb(分片+副本)集群。 在搭建集群之前,需要首先了解几个概念:路由,分片、副本集、配置服务器等。相关概念mongodb集群架构图: 从图中可以看到有四个组件:mongos ...